What can you expect during an evaluation in private?

A private ADHD assessment is typically an organized interview with a medical professional who will inquire about your symptoms and how they impact your life. Additionally, you will be asked to complete an array of questionnaires as well as certain cognitive tests to give the complete picture of your situation. These tools are usually non-invasive and painless.

Before your appointment, you will be asked to fill out pre-screening questions. These questionnaires will allow your psychiatrist to determine if you meet the ADHD diagnostic criteria. Please return these as soon as you can prior to your consultation so that you don't have to wait long before your appointment.

When you visit your psychiatrist consultant they will go over your medical history and lifestyle, taking into account any issues you might have experienced in your life recently. It is essential to be honest with your doctor to help them know what is happening and make an accurate diagnosis.

During the interview your psychiatrist will discuss any concerns you may have about your performance at your work or with others. They will also take into account any other symptoms you might be experiencing, such as depression and anxiety. If they believe these are a result of your ADHD they will talk about the issue with you and suggest any treatment options that they believe will be beneficial to you.

After your psychiatrist has completed the interview, they will go over all the information you've provided. The psychiatrist will discuss their findings with you, and answer any questions you might have. If necessary, they will recommend that you start medication and give you a prescription.

What is the cost for an assessment conducted by a private person?

The cost of an individual ADHD assessment can be expensive. There are options available for those who cannot afford the full cost. For example, some providers offer a sliding scale of rates dependent on a person's income. Some also provide pro bono assessments for those who cannot afford a full evaluation.
